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service by following site-specific security-related procedures, screening access points, and supporting emergency response activities when appropriate.
  • Monitor employee, visitor, and vendor entry and exit at the location by verifying credentials, maintaining visitor logs, and reporting unusual activity to site contacts and/or Allied Universal leadership.
  • Support access control for deliveries, shipping and receiving areas, and restricted production spaces in a food and beverage location while following posted protocols and escalation procedures.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, documenting observations and communicating with supervisors and/or local responders as needed.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ols around the location and perimeter to help identify security-related concerns, access issues, and policy violations.
